On this episode of Bad Comic Reviews: We're looking at Star Wars: Life Day issue 1. This one-shot comic book was produced by Marvel Comics. Han Solo bridges several short adventures spanning from the High Republic to the Classic trilogy era in this anthology.

Framing Sequence (1st Story): Written by Cavan Scott, art by Ivan Fiorelli, colors by Chris Sotomayor, with letters by Ariana Maher.
Deck the Halls (2nd Story): Written by Justina Ireland, art by Georges Jeanty, colors by Victor Olazaba, with letters by Ariana Maher.
Paid on Delivery (3rd Story): Written by Steve Orlando, art by Paul Fry, colors by Alex Sinclair, with letters by Ariana Maher.
Gift of Light (4th Story): Written by Jody Houser, art by Kei Zama, colors by Ruth Redmond, with letters by Ariana Maher.
Cover by Phil Noto.
